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Quakers Yard to Reedham (Norfolk) start from as little as £27.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Quakers Yard to Reedham (Norfolk) start from £166.60 one way, or £167.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Quakers Yard to Reedham (Norfolk) are available for £222.80 one way, or £374.50 return

Facilities and Services

Though small, Quakers Yard station is efficient and functional. It doesn't feature a staffed ticket office, but it compensates by offering ticket machines that are accessible to all passengers, including those with mobility challenges. You can also collect tickets bought online from these machines. Induction loops are available, enhancing the experience for passengers with hearing impairments.

For assistance, help points are strategically placed throughout the station. Departure and arrival screens ensure you're kept up to date with train timings. It's worth noting that while there isn't a waiting room or toilet facilities on the premises, there are seating areas available for your comfort. Luggage storage is not available, so traveling light is advisable.

Facilities and Amenities at Reedham Station

At Reedham (Norfolk) station, travelers enjoy essential amenities designed for comfort and convenience. Although the station lacks a traditional ticket office, it features efficient ticket machines ensuring quick access to your travel documents. Collecting tickets purchased online is seamless, and the station enhances accessibility with induction loops and step-free access to Platform 1 from the car park. For those requiring aid, support is available through customer help points, with assistance bookings available via the Passenger Assist service.

While basic amenities like toilets and refreshment facilities are absent, Reedham captures visitors' needs with covered seating areas and ample bicycle storage. The station is equipped with CCTV for added security, while the adjacent parking facilities offer affordable rates with spaces for daily and annual use.
